Indian national arrested with brown sugar in Jhapa



JHAPA: An Indian national has been arrested along with narcotic substance brown sugar from Kachanakawal-1, the rural municipality in the southern part of Jhapa district.

The arrested has been identified as 32-year-old Farbed Alam of Sukhanadigi Padampur, Kishangunj, Bihar in India, District Police Office Jhapa’s Deputy Superintendent Rakesh Thapa said.

A police team deputed from the District police Office Jhapa arrested Alam while carrying out a checking at Bagan at Kachanakabal while he was coming towards Nepal from India.

Police confiscated 11.65 grammes brown sugar from him.

Alam has been kept at the District police Office Jhapa for necessary action, police stated.
